Definitions of incoherently word
- adjective incoherently without logical or meaningful connection; disjointed; rambling: an incoherent sentence. 1
- adjective incoherently characterized by such thought or language, as a person: incoherent with rage. 1
- adjective incoherently not coherent or cohering: an incoherent mixture. 1
- adjective incoherently lacking physical cohesion; loose: incoherent dust. 1
- adjective incoherently lacking unity or harmony of elements: an incoherent public. 1
- adjective incoherently lacking congruity of parts; uncoordinated. 1

Origin of incoherently
First appearance:
before 1620 One of the 42% oldest English words
First recorded in 1620-30; in-3 + coherent
